What is the Google Analytics Test?

The Google Analytics Individual Qualification (GAIQ) test is a certification exam offered by Google to validate a user’s knowledge and proficiency in using Google Analytics. It is a widely recognized certification that signifies your ability to understand and apply Google Analytics data to real-world scenarios.

The exam tests a broad range of topics, including setting up tracking codes, understanding data flow, analyzing traffic sources, interpreting reports, and using advanced features like segmentation, goals, and custom reports.

The Google Analytics certification is free and available to anyone who wants to showcase their expertise in digital analytics. By passing the exam, you demonstrate a comprehensive understanding of Google Analytics, which is highly valued in the marketing, data analytics, and business intelligence industries.

How to Prepare for the Google Analytics Test

1. Use Google’s Free Resources
Google offers several free resources to help you prepare for the exam, including their official Google Analytics Academy. This platform provides online courses, tutorials, and training videos that cover all the key topics tested on the exam. The Google Analytics Individual Qualification Exam Study Guide is a great place to start.

**2. Take a Google Analytics Practice Test
Practice tests are a great way to familiarize yourself with the exam format and question types. Taking a Google Analytics certification practice test allows you to identify areas where you need improvement and increase your speed and accuracy in answering questions.

3. Review the Google Analytics Help Center
The Google Analytics Help Center contains a wealth of articles and guides that cover every aspect of the platform. Spend time reading through the documentation to ensure that you fully understand the different features and functionalities available in Google Analytics.

4. Explore Real-World Case Studies
Applying the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ios is essential for mastering Google Analytics. Work on case studies or mock scenarios where you can practice configuring Google Analytics, analyzing data, and building reports for a fictional business.

5. Use Online Courses and Tutorials
There are many online platforms that offer Google Analytics certification preparation, including Udemy, Coursera, and LinkedIn Learning. These courses typically offer in-depth lessons on every aspect of Google Analytics and can help you understand difficult topics more clearly.

What is the Google Analytics certification exam?

The Google Analytics certification is a professional credential offered by Google through its Skillshop platform. It validates your proficiency in Google Analytics 4, covering data collection, reporting, exploration tools, and campaign measurement. Earning this certification demonstrates to employers and clients that you understand how to use GA4 to analyze website and app performance effectively.

What format is the Google Analytics certification exam?

The Google Analytics certification exam is a multiple-choice test taken entirely online through Google Skillshop. You have 75 minutes to complete the exam, and questions are presented one at a time. There is no proctoring requirement, so you can take the test from any location with a stable internet connection and a Google account.

What is the passing score for the Google Analytics certification?

You need to score 80% or higher to pass the Google Analytics certification exam. That means you must answer at least 40 out of 50 questions correctly. If you do not pass on your first attempt, you must wait 24 hours before retaking the exam. There is no limit on the number of retake attempts.

What topics are covered on the Google Analytics exam?

The exam covers GA4 property setup and data collection, event tracking and custom dimensions, exploration reports and funnel analysis, audience building and segmentation, attribution models, Google Ads integration, and data privacy controls. You should also understand key metrics like engagement rate, conversions, and user lifecycle reporting within the GA4 interface.

Are there any eligibility requirements for the Google Analytics certification?

There are no formal eligibility requirements for the Google Analytics certification. Anyone with a Google account can access Google Skillshop and take the exam at no cost. Google does not require any prerequisite courses, prior certifications, or professional experience. However, completing the free Google Analytics training courses on Skillshop before attempting the exam is strongly recommended.

How do I register for the Google Analytics certification exam?

Visit skillshop.withgoogle.com and sign in with your Google account. Navigate to the Google Analytics certification section under the Google Analytics category. You can start the exam immediately or work through the free training modules first. No scheduling or advance registration is required, and the entire process from account creation to certification is handled within Skillshop.

How long is the Google Analytics certification valid?

The Google Analytics certification is valid for 12 months from the date you pass the exam. After it expires, you must retake and pass the current version of the exam to maintain your certified status. Google periodically updates the exam content to reflect new GA4 features, so recertification ensures your knowledge stays current with the latest platform changes.

What study materials does Google provide for the Analytics certification?

Google offers a free self-paced training course on Skillshop called Google Analytics for Beginners and an advanced GA4 course that together cover all exam topics. These modules include video lessons, hands-on activities using a demo GA4 property, and short knowledge checks after each section. Working through both courses typically takes 4 to 6 hours and closely mirrors the content tested on the certification exam.
